A KIDDERMINSTER man has admitted six counts of exposure, sexual activity in the presence of a child and producing cannabis.
John Schuck, aged 43, of Stourbridge Road, admitted six counts of exposure when he appeared at Worcester Crown Court.
Sobbing could be heard from the public gallery above the dock as he entered his pleas to the six counts which cover a period between November 1, 2012 and May 4 this year.
He further admitted engaging in sexual activity in the presence of a child on April 28 this year and production of a controlled drug of class B (five cannabis plants), also on April 28 this year.
Because Shuck is now a convicted sex offender he is subject to notification requirements and registration provisions.
The case was adjourned until July 30 to allow a pre-sentence report to be prepared.
Schuck was remanded in custody until the next hearing.
